The Name Abraxus Is a Symbol of the 365 Days of the Year

Abraxus was an important figure in folk magic of the greco roman period. The seven letters in abraxus name denote the seven days of the week and, likewise, the seven ruling planets of traditional astrology. This concept was so ingrained in human culture that there are still echoes of it in modern times. It is a symbol of the dissolution of opposites, part of a key concept in yung's disharmony theory.
